Daal Gosht

ZMA
ZMA @zesty5

#week2of5
#cookpadindia
A very famous and a delectable preparation with Bengal Gram or Chana Daal and meat. It is a perfect side dish for Lunch and is a lovely accompaniment to Phulkas, Chapatis and Rotis as well. Though it's a dry one, it goes well with plain boiled Rice alongside Dal, Rasam, Kadhi etc. It's a quickie in terms of cooking time. The only thing is to soak the Lentil for a good 2-3 hours. That's it. The rest of the process is pretty much easy. A sumptuous treat to the tastebuds, this Lentil and Meat combo is loved by many across the Country as well as in many neighbouring Asian Countries too.
A good source of Proteins and Carbohydrates, this one wins it hands down.

Ingredients

30-35 minutes
5-6 servings
  • 1 1/2 cupsBengal Gram or Chana Daal soaked
  • 1/2 (1 kg)Mutton Bone-in
  • 2 tspGinger garlic paste
  • 1 tspSalt or to taste
  • 1 tspCumin powder roasted
  • 2 tspRed Chilli powder
  • 1/2 tspTurmeric powder
  • 1 tspChana Masala
  • 3 tbspOil
  • 2Onions finely chopped
  • 1small bunch Coriander Leaves finely chopped
  • 2Green Chillies finely chopped
  • 1 tspDry Mango powder or Amchur homemade

Steps

30-35 minutes
  1. 1

    Soak Dal for about 3 hours. Boil with little Salt and set aside. It should be firm yet soft. Water quantity should be as minimal as possible. In a Pressure Cooker, heat Oil and saute Onions with Ginger garlic paste until light brownish in colour. Add Green Chillies and Mutton Bone-in now. Mix well and saute for 5 minutes. Add the rest of the ingredients and pressure cook on high for 8 whistles or as required.

  2. 2

    To this cooked meat, add in the boiled Dal and give them all a good mix. Take care while mixing so that Dal doesn't break up. Simmer on a low heat for about 15 more minutes. The consistency is semi dry. Do not add more water.

    A picture of step 2 of Daal Gosht.
  3. 3

    Garnish with lots of freshly chopped Coriander Leaves. Serve piping hot with Rice and any side dish of your choice. Enjoy!
